Auto Repair & Maintenance in London, ON - page 15
Find accurate info on the best auto repair shops in London. Get reviews and contact details for each business, including phone number, address, opening hours, promotions and other information.
Showing results: 281 - 300 out of 332
Showing results: 281 - 300 out of 332
Other results from the 'Auto Repair & Maintenance' category in London

Closed now
171 Exeter Road, London, N6L 1A4
(519) 652-6699


Closed now
205 Exeter Rd, LONGWOODS, London, N6L 1A4
(519) 652-9303


Closed now
982 Springbank Drive, London, N6K 1A5
(519) 471-0050



Closed now
629 CENTRAL AVENUE, EAST LONDON, London, N5W 3P7
(519) 645-8463


Closed now
1027 Pine Street, HAMILTON ROAD, London, N5Z 2J7
+1 519-452-1100


420 Springbank, London, N6J 1G8
+1 519-473-3110


1094 Commissioners Road West, London, N6K 1C4
+1 519-471-4671


512 Horton St E, London, N6B 1M5
+1 519-432-8000


6151 Colonel Talbot Rd, London, N6P 1J2
(519) 652-6610


284 Adelaide St S, GLEN CAIRN, London, N5Z 3L1
(519) 686-7216


213 Consortium Court, London, N6E 2S8


241 Horton Street East, London, N6B 1L1
+1 519-438-1330


129 Falcon St, London, N5W 4Z2
(519) 646-2930


72 Mackay Avenue, SOUTHCREST, London, N6J 2V5
(519) 433-3632


2080 OXFORD ST E, AIRPORT, London, N5V 2Z8
(519) 451-7391

115 Clarke Rd, London, N5V 2E1
(519) 852-7584



140 CLARKE ROAD, ARGYLE, London, N5W 5E1
(519) 453-9123
